The plot of this is basically: the lost eighth type of fairies yeeted their island into a temporal rift because they got annoyed. The spell they used to do that is starting to fall apart. So now they start randomly appearing, and everyone's trying to stop it.
Due to plot stuff with other humans figuring out about the time spell, Artemis, Holly, and two of those new fairies |go back to the island and hatch a plan to convert a bomb explosion to magic and put the island back where it's supposed to be. (I KNOW THIS IS SPOILER TAGGED BUT THIS IS LITERALLY THE ENDING I'M SPOILING HERE) Well, almost. It comes back twenty miles off target and three years after they left.|
